Key Points

Positve
  • Repco Home Finance Ltd (BOM:535322) declared a 25% interim dividend, celebrating 25 years of service.
  • The company achieved its highest-ever disbursements and sanctions in Q1 FY26, with disbursements at INR829 crore and sanctions at INR907 crore.
  • Gross NPA improved significantly to 3.3% from 4.3% in the previous year, indicating better asset quality management.
  • The company has diversified its borrowing sources by reissuing commercial paper worth INR150 crore, aiming to improve funding sources and manage costs.
  • Repco Home Finance Ltd (BOM:535322) has seen a notable improvement in its cost-to-income ratio, which stands at 24.26% for Q1 FY26.
Negative
  • Stage 2 assets remain high at 9.7%, compared to peers who are in the range of 1.3% to 4.7%.
  • The company faces challenges in reducing NPAs, with a target to bring GNPA down to 2.5% by year-end.
  • There is pressure from balance transfers (BT-out), with INR60-65 crore experienced in April to June, although BT-in is higher.
  • Asset quality stress is noted in regions like Karnataka and Telangana, although the company claims it is manageable.
  • The company's valuation is less than one-time price to book, which is lower compared to peers valued at three-plus price to book.
